The President of Pridnestrovie received the United States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ador to Moldova

07/01/15

President of Pridnestrovie Yevgeny Shevchuk received U.S.A.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ador to the RM James Pettit.

Attention was paid to the issues related to the current situation in the relations between Pridnestrovie and Moldova. In addition, they talked about the consequences of the impact of regional instability on the economy of Pridnestrovie, as well as blocking measures taken by Moldova and Ukraine. The action of restrictions created artificially by neighbouring countries on foreign economic activity of business entities of the PMR continues to adversely affect the revenues of the country. During the meeting, the Pridnestrovian side also expressed concern about the situation at the Pridnestrovian-Ukrainian border.

“As before, we are ready to build constructive relations with Kishinev and Kiev to lift the blockade against the economy so that it can function, provide citizens with all necessary”, said the President of Pridnestrovie. “I hope that our partners in the future together with us will look at the negotiating table for a compromise formula for the solution of these problems”, said Yevgeny Shevchuk.

 “We want to express our support for Pridnestrovie, we want the prosperity be here, people live well. We support actions that contribute to the improvement of life in Pridnestrovie”,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ador to Moldova James Pettit said after the meeting.

We remind that the previous meeting of President of Pridnestrovie Yevgeny Shevchuk and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ador to Moldova James Pettit took place on February 24, 2015.
